Microchip Technology dsPIC™ 30F series Microcontrollers are a family of 16-bit digital signal controllers (DSCs) that offer a wide range of features and performance. They are designed to provide a high level of integration, flexibility, and performance for a variety of applications. The dsPIC 30F series features a powerful 16-bit CPU core, a wide range of peripherals, and a variety of memory options. The dsPIC 30F series is ideal for applications such as motor control, digital power conversion, digital signal processing, and embedded control. With its high performance and low power consumption, the dsPIC 30F series is an excellent choice for embedded applications.

Applications


• Motor Control: The microcontrollers are used in motor control applications, such as brushless DC motors, AC induction motors, and stepper motors.

• Power Electronics: These microcontrollers can be used in power electronics systems such as inverters, switching regulators, and power factor correction circuits.

• Automotive: These microcontrollers can be used in automotive applications like engine management systems, transmission control units, and other vehicle control modules.

• Audio and Signal Processing: The dsPIC™ 30F microcontrollers can be used in audio and signal processing applications for filtering, amplification, and other digital signal processing operations.

• Motor Drives: These microcontrollers are used in motor drives such as treadmill motors, fans, pumps etc., where precise control at high speed is required

What are the differences between the types of Microchip Technology dsPIC™ 30F series Microcontrollers?

1. Memory: The dsPIC30F series microcontrollers come in a variety of memory sizes, ranging from 8K to 128K of program memory and from 256 bytes to 4K of data memory.  2. Clock Speed: The dsPIC30F series microcontrollers come in a variety of clock speeds, ranging from 4 MHz to 40 MHz.  3. Peripherals: The dsPIC30F series microcontrollers come with a variety of peripherals, including UARTs, SPI, I2C, PWM, and ADC.  4. Packages: The dsPIC30F series microcontrollers come in a variety of packages, including DIP, SOIC, and QFN.  5. Power Consumption: The dsPIC30F series microcontrollers come in a variety of power consumption levels, ranging from 0.5 mA/MHz to 1.5 mA/MHz.
